Our Casting Sessions

During our baby casting  sessions we keep things calm & relaxed. We will be led by baby. First we massage those little feet & toes. Secondly we mix up a gloopy mixture & gently pop baby's hand/ foot into it.

This will set within minutes to a soft rubbery texture. We wiggle baby out & the mould is made. We can cast whilst baby is awake, asleep, feeding or even wiggling!

During our toddler/child/family casting sessions we will keep things fun. There are always toys at the ready. We can cast whilst playing & chattering, in between tickling & chasing!


Our framed plaster casts are usually finished within 4 weeks & our solid bronze sculptures within 12 weeks. Each of our casts begin in the same way with the initial mould making. The difference being to become solid bronze metal casts we work through a highly skilled process. This involves silicone moulds, wax casts & ceramic shell building before reaching the molten metal stage. We fire all of our bronze casts ourselves. We take great pride in each part of the process to maintain those treasured intricate details in each & every cast.
